Azuki NFT Review: The Anime Avatar Mission Killed by Its Founder

Key Takeaways

  • Azuki is an NFT series of 10,000 anime-inspired avatars that peaked in recognition in early 2022 sooner than falling from grace.
  • The clarification for the downfall modified into as soon as a single mistake from with out a doubt one of many project’s founders, Zagabond, who naively ousted himself as an opportunistic leader of three previous failed NFT initiatives.
  • The file-excessive floor designate for an Azuki reached $115,000 in April. This day, one piece is rate about $12,000, marking an nearly tenfold fall from the stop.

Whereas loads of NFT initiatives contain launched since the NFT avatar scene exploded in early 2021, no longer too many went from zero to hero, and even fewer circled the total plot back. However Azuki did correct that: after reaching peak hype within months of open, it suffered a tumble into mediocrity. 

The Upward thrust

Launched in January 2022 by four nameless founders, Azuki modified into as soon as with out a doubt one of many few avatar NFT collections that all people believed had performed every little thing stunning. The execution on Chiru Labs’ half, the startup in the back of Azuki, modified into as soon as so merely that many rapid modified into joyful the project might possibly presumably also prove to be “the following Bored Ape Yacht Membership”—then and restful essentially the most prized NFT series in the nascent industry. Christian Williams, the Editor-in-Chief at Crypto Briefing, wrote a column in April praising the series and advising groups that hoped to invent the following six-figure blue chip avatar to withhold in mind Azuki’s phenomenal execution.

And back then, he wasn’t too far off the keep. Azuki’s artwork modified into as soon as—and restful is—a cut above the remainder. The lore: top-notch. The neighborhood modified into as soon as brilliant and rising. The roadmap, or as Azuki known because it, the “mindmap,” modified into as soon as promising and neatly idea-out, but probably most importantly, it existed. Many NFT collections of the form don’t contain a roadmap at all, let alone a crew in a position to executing it. Azuki perceived to contain it all and modified into as soon as lucky ample to receive neighborhood recognition. The 10,000-item series sold out on open, minting for approximately 1 ETH apiece. Gross sales on the secondary market at as soon as started ramping up, reaching a floor designate of about 7 ETH in most efficient days following open and about 15 ETH by the month’s stop.

By mid-March, the series’s floor designate tanked to about 9 ETH, with passion a miniature bit waning off, but then Chiru started turning in surprises the neighborhood couldn’t bag ample of. On March 30, the crew airdropped 20,000 “something” NFTs to Azuki holders, rekindling huge passion from speculators in each the series and the airdropped somethings. A day after the fall, the unpacked digital affords—later unveiled as Azuki sidekick avatars dubbed BEANZ—reached a floor designate of about 3.14 ETH, striking the cumulative price of the airdrop at over $213 million. This equated to a payout of round $21,000 for every Azuki avatar collectors held.

In the lead-as a lot as the airdrop, the series’s floor prize doubled from round 9 ETH to about 18 ETH, and in a few short days following the fall, it nearly doubled again, reaching about 34 ETH, then rate approximately $115,000. In April, the s0-known as “skaters of the Web” were at the height of the hype ramp, doing Bean Flowers and drawing dismay and applause from most of all people in the digital collectibles neighborhood. It modified into as soon as then when chatter that Azukis might possibly presumably also reach blue chip location and even doubtlessly flip BAYC started ramping up on NFT Twitter. The ground designate of BAYC in April went from round 110 ETH to its file-excessive designate of round 155 ETH, while Azukis were procuring and selling at roughly 30 ETH. Yet restful, recount of the flippening modified into as soon as ongoing, and loads of collectors perceived to think it.

On the opposite hand, that modified into as soon as unless with out a doubt one of Azuki’s nameless founders, going below Zagabond on Twitter, naively determined to invent a grave blunder: recount about his previous failures.

The Drop From Grace

On Can also merely 9, Zagabond printed a blog post titled “A Builder’s Dart.” In it, he unfolded about his previous failures in the NFT home and outlined one of the most classes he realized in his gallop. “For the length of these formative cases, it’s crucial that the neighborhood encourages creators to innovate and experiment. Additionally, every experiment comes with key learnings,” he acknowledged.

Whereas his intentions might possibly presumably also were pure, in hindsight, it modified into as soon as with out a doubt one of many worst errors Zagabond might possibly presumably also invent, because it most efficient tarnished the impeccable rate Azuki had constructed up to now by linking it to fraught initiatives that many in the neighborhood subsequently went on to keep as outright scams. He revealed that he had led CryptoPhunks, Tendies, and CryptoZunks—three NFT initiatives that will possibly presumably at closing depart to black.

CryptoPhunks modified into as soon as hit with a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A) takedown inquire by CryptoPunks—the first NFT series to reach blue chip location—after which Zagabond modified into as soon as compelled to abandon it. However he did no longer enact it with out first making monetary institution, as one Twitter user identified. In accordance with on-chain records, months after CryptoPhunks went bust, its creator performed a “wash substitute” on the NFT marketplace LooksRare for a revenue of 300 ETH after rising the creator royalty charge to 5%. Wash procuring and selling is a have of market manipulation performed to artificially inflate procuring and selling volumes for a particular asset. It’s far illegal in used markets, as spiking procuring and selling volumes might possibly presumably also mislead patrons into pondering there’s a proper passion in the asset.

Zagabond’s second NFT experiment, Tendies, failed from the bag-depart, with most efficient 15% of the series minted at open. On the opposite hand, one collector going by 2070 on Twitter identified that Tendies modified into as soon as successfully a rug pull. In accordance with the nameless collector, who allegedly participated in the Tendies mint, the project ceased all exercise post-open, suddenly deleted all social media, and closed the Discord channel within a month of the mint.

With CryptoZunks, Zagabond modified into as soon as ousted for collaborating in questionable conduct to promote the project on social media. Sooner than the open, he allegedly posed as a woman named Amanda and inclined a female CryptoZunk profile picture on Twitter. To many observers, Zagabond outed themselves as an opportunistic NFT founder that hopped from one project to the following with miniature regard for patrons unless he struck gold.

To top it all off, when Zagabond did strike gold with Azuki, he by some means managed to turn it into lead by severely negative the project’s recognition. In the days following the publishing of his blog post, Azuki’s designate floor more than halved, plunging from round 20 ETH to about 7.5 ETH.

The Voice of Play

Whereas many NFT initiatives contain reach and long previous over the closing year, the Web skaters’ tumble from grace will probably stay inked in the NFT historical previous books as with out a doubt one of many worst in historical previous. No longer because Azuki hit an absolute backside—far from it—but because it modified into as soon as with out a doubt one of essentially the most efficient initiatives that as a minimal looked fancy it had a proper chance of overthrowing the two industry darlings, CryptoPunks and Bored Apes.

And while Azukis restful relate a hefty designate, with the series excellent the eleventh-greatest by total market capitalization, their downfall—as measured from their file to their most neatly-liked designate—is sophisticated to overstate. At their all-time highs, Azukis’ floor designate modified into as soon as round $115,000. This day, it’s about $12,000, marking an nearly tenfold fall from the stop. For comparability, CryptoPunks and BAYC fetched round $440,000 and $435,000 at their all-time highs, and at the present time they substitute for approximately $127,000 and $114,000, respectively.

The silver lining in this chronicle is that Azuki’s decline might possibly be at threat of coach NFT collectors a treasured lesson: every recognition-essentially based project, even essentially the most promising one, is one naive mistake from fading into obscurity. 

Azuki’s chronicle is no longer accomplished, and collectors might possibly presumably also very neatly watch a redemption arc, but the extinct adage restful applies: recognition is fancy a home of cards—it takes a in reality lengthy time to form and is readily blown away.
